Small Oval Punch107304, Scallop Oval Punch 114889, Wide Oval Punch 112082, Scallop Edge Punch 112091, Craft White Reinker 101780, Mat Pack 105826, Snail Adhesive 104332Punch out the body of the bat with the SMALL OVAL PUNCH.
Create the bat ears on the top of the oval by using the SCALLOP EDGE PUNCH to nip a little "V" out.
Step One to create the bat wings is to punch a SCALLOP OVAL.

Step Two is using the WIDE OVAL PUNCH to punch just above the scallop oval.
Add the eyes by dipping a stylus into a drop of CRAFT WHITE REINKER and dotting each eye.
Attach the wings to the body with SNAIL ADHESIVE. Punch a hole in the bat belly using the MAT PACK with a paper piercing tool. Using clear transparent, thread the bat belly and tie a knot. Tip: I put eyes on both sides of the bat so it always has eyes showing as it dangles from the spooky tree!I hope this inspires you to make some fun little bats for your Halloween decorations.
